diff options
author | will <will@FreeBSD.org> | 2002-05-20 06:31:31 +0800 |
---|---|---|
committer | will <will@FreeBSD.org> | 2002-05-20 06:31:31 +0800 |
commit | 3ccdc9a04b53dfd428fa067ca51b4634a0303efe (patch) | |
tree | f305962efaf93767d3aec4d11148e1fb2c02633f /astro/xplanet/Makefile | |
parent | e36577356fe8ebd21573a4715f6a713eb3880644 (diff) | |
download | freebsd-ports-gnome-3ccdc9a04b53dfd428fa067ca51b4634a0303efe.tar.gz freebsd-ports-gnome-3ccdc9a04b53dfd428fa067ca51b4634a0303efe.tar.zst freebsd-ports-gnome-3ccdc9a04b53dfd428fa067ca51b4634a0303efe.zip |
Update to 0.94. Greatly simplify this port by removing the options to
use a specific version of Tk and other fluff. Install the markers that
come with the xearth port.
PR: 36185 (Update to 0.93)
Submitted by: Lars Eggert <larse@isi.edu>
Diffstat (limited to 'astro/xplanet/Makefile')
-rw-r--r-- | astro/xplanet/Makefile | 80 |
1 files changed, 25 insertions, 55 deletions
diff --git a/astro/xplanet/Makefile b/astro/xplanet/Makefile index d4daf800e280..be7a2f547b02 100644 --- a/astro/xplanet/Makefile +++ b/astro/xplanet/Makefile @@ -6,83 +6,53 @@ # PORTNAME= xplanet -PORTVERSION= 0.84 -CATEGORIES= astro x11 -M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} \ - http://www.radcyberzine.com/xglobe/ +PORTVERSION= 0.94 +CATEGORIES= astro +MASTER_SITES= ${MASTER_SITE_SOURCEFORGE} MASTER_SITE_SUBDIR= ${PORTNAME} -DISTFILES= ${DISTNAME}${EXTRACT_SUFX} depths_800.jpg -EXTRACT_ONLY= ${DISTNAME}${EXTRACT_SUFX} MAINTAINER= will@FreeBSD.org -LIB_DEPENDS= jpeg.9:${PORTSDIR}/graphics/jpeg +LIB_DEPENDS+= jpeg.9:${PORTSDIR}/graphics/jpeg \ + freetype.9:${PORTSDIR}/print/freetype2 \ + ungif.5:${PORTSDIR}/graphics/libungif \ + png.5:${PORTSDIR}/graphics/png \ + tiff.4:${PORTSDIR}/graphics/tiff \ + pnm.1:${PORTSDIR}/graphics/netpbm + +RUN_DEPENDS= wish8.3:${PORTSDIR}/x11-toolkits/tk83 USE_X_PREFIX= yes USE_MESA= yes USE_GMAKE= yes -USE_IMLIB= yes GNU_CONFIGURE= yes -CONFIGURE_ARGS= --with-map-extension=jpg + +CONFIGURE_ARGS= --with-map-extension=jpg --with-freetype --with-gif \ + --with-png --with-pnm --with-tiff + C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include -I${X11BASE}/include" \ - LIBS="-L${LOCALBASE}/lib -L${X11BASE}/lib -lm" + LIBS="-L${LOCALBASE}/lib -L${X11BASE}/lib -lm" \ + WISH=${LOCALBASE}/bin/wish8.3 + MAKE_ENV= CPPFLAGS="-I${LOCALBASE}/include -I${X11BASE}/include" \ LIBS="-L${LOCALBASE}/lib -L${X11BASE}/lib -lm" MAN1= xplanet.1 xplanetbg.1 tkxplanet.1 tzcoord.pl.1 +MANCOMPRESSED= no .include <bsd.port.pre.mk> -.if (!defined(WITH_TK80) && !defined(WITH_TK81) && !defined(WITH_TK82) && !defined(WITH_TK83)) -.if exists(${LOCALBASE}/bin/wish8.3) -WITH_TK83= yes -.elif exists(${LOCALBASE}/bin/wish8.2) -WITH_TK82= yes -.elif exists(${LOCALBASE}/bin/wish8.1) -WITH_TK81= yes -.else -WITH_TK80= yes -.endif -.endif - -.if defined(WITH_TK80) -RUN_DEPENDS= wish8.0:${PORTSDIR}/x11-toolkits/tk80 -WISH= ${LOCALBASE}/bin/wish8.0 -TKVERMSG= "Using Tk 8.0" -.endif - -.if defined(WITH_TK81) -RUN_DEPENDS= wish8.1:${PORTSDIR}/x11-toolkits/tk81 -WISH= ${LOCALBASE}/bin/wish8.1 -TKVERMSG= "Using Tk 8.1" -.endif - -.if defined(WITH_TK82) -RUN_DEPENDS= wish8.2:${PORTSDIR}/x11-toolkits/tk82 -WISH= ${LOCALBASE}/bin/wish8.2 -TKVERMSG= "Using Tk 8.2" -.endif - -.if defined(WITH_TK83) -RUN_DEPENDS= wish8.3:${PORTSDIR}/x11-toolkits/tk83 -WISH= ${LOCALBASE}/bin/wish8.3 -TKVERMSG= "Using Tk 8.3" -.endif - -CONFIGURE_ENV+= WISH=${WISH} - -pre-fetch: - @${ECHO} ${TKVERMSG} - @${ECHO} "Define WITH_TK80, WITH_TK81, WITH_TK82, or WITH_TK83" - @${ECHO} "To use a different version of TK" - pre-configure: - @${PERL} -pi -e 's|-O3|${CFLAGS}|' ${WRKSRC}/configure + @${PERL} -pi -e 's|-O3||' ${WRKSRC}/configure pre-build: @${PERL} -pi -e "s:/usr/local:${PREFIX}:g" ${WRKSRC}/auxfiles.h +# Install the list of FreeBSD sites & committers locations from astro/xearth post-install: - @${INSTALL_DATA} ${DISTDIR}/depths_800.jpg ${PREFIX}/share/xplanet/earth.jpg +.for file in freebsd.committers.markers freebsd.ftp.markers + @${INSTALL_DATA} ${PORTSDIR}/astro/xearth/files/${file} \ + ${PREFIX}/share/xplanet/markers +.endfor .include <bsd.port.post.mk> |